The travel industry showed off its glamourous side when reigning Miss World visited ITB Berlin 2010. The Gibraltarian beauty, who won the prestigious beauty contest in Johannesburg in December, dropped by the South Africa stand to catch up with friends and give the nation a final cheer ahead of FIFA 2010.

The Indian Union Ministry of Tourism has unveiled one of the largest pavilions at ITB Berlin, offering guests a chance to explore the nation’s travel offering. While the Commonwealth Games are sure to top the agenda, medical, wellness, rural, MICE, and caravan tourism are also vying for space.
